Branched Evolution

Competitive Programming in Python

グリッド

ABC 186 F - Rook on Grid

障害物の置かれたグリッド上で飛車が2回で移動できる範囲を求める。

ABC 179 F - Simplified Reversi

$n \times n$ のグリッドの行または列を選択し,すでに塗られているマスに到達するまでマスを塗りつぶすという操作を $q$ 回行い,最終的に塗られていないマスの数を求める.( $n,q \leq 2 \times 10 ^ {5}$ )